Georgia carpenter wins lottery twice in a week
One week after winning $1,000 in the Georgia Lottery, a 62-year-old carpenter struck it really big. Earl Fritz took home the top prize of $777,777 in the instant game Super Lucky 7's. I felt lucky last week, the Augusta resident said. Now I feel a little bit luckier. He purchased his ticket at Ms. Carolyn's, 2416 Windsor Spring Road, and scratched it. At first, Fritz didn't realize what he had. I didn't have my glasses on, he said. It looked like a blur. Fritz's first win came ...

$200,000 Powerball prize awarded on day lottery ticket was set to expire
Mother urged winner to check tickets, having heard news of upcoming expiration William H. Greer of Philadelphia is the winner of a $200,000 Powerball prize that was set to expire at 4:30 p.m. today. At Choi's Food and Beer, 3987 Ford Rd, in the Wynnefield section of the city, they knew the ticket sold there that matched all five white numbers (but not the red Powerball number) from last year's June 18th drawing was still out there somewhere. My mother saw the news about the unclaimed t ...

Euro Millions lottery winner is gardener and 'nice chap'
Onion-growing granddad Brian Caswell will jet to Rio and buy a flash car after claiming a 25 million (US$40.8 million) Euro Millions lottery jackpot. But the 74-year-old, who won half the Euro Millions jackpot last Friday, said he and wife Joan, 72, would not move far from their modest home in Bolton, Greater Manchester. CCTV footage captured the happy winner punching the air at his local newsagent on learning he had won on Saturday. He is Britain's third-biggest Lotto winner ever and t ...

Husband, then wife, wins lottery
The Hills were excited when they won $5,000 from the Georgia Lottery. But excited doesn't begin to cover how they felt one week later, when they won again this time a $1 million prize. I was really ecstatic about the $5,000, Hill said, but then, boom! When I got this one I was just like, 'Wow, I can't believe this. My life is going to change for the better.' Karen Hill, a 34-year-old mother of two, bought the winning ticket for the World Class Millions instant game at City Chevron, 701 E ...

Lucky grandparents strike it big in Ga. lottery
Apparently, it pays to be a grandparent. The latest big winners in the Georgia Lottery have a combined 17 grandchildren between them. Brenda Lee, 60, who works at a lawn-mower assembly plant, won $500,000 in the instant game Jumbo Bucks. The Statesboro woman bought the ticket at Ambe Food Mart and scratched it in her car. I called my daughter and asked her to come quickly because I couldn't drive, said Lee, who has two children and four grandchildren. I also showed the clerk. I just co ...

Forgotten lottery ticket worth $250,000
A lottery ticket tucked away in a wallet for months turned out to be a winner, worth $250,000. Michael Johnson, of Lexington, Ky., bought the Mega Millions ticket during a business trip to metro Atlanta back in February. He slipped the lottery ticket into his wallet and forgot about it. Last week he found the three-month old ticket, checked the numbers, and found out he was holding a winning ticket. He matched all five numbers in the drawing, but not the mega ball. S.D. rancher claims $232M Powerball lottery jackpot
If this were a movie, nobody would believe it: A rancher struggling to eke out a living in one of the poorest corners of America claimed one of the biggest undivided jackpots in U.S. lottery history Friday $232 million after buying the ticket in a town by the name of Winner. Neal Wanless, 23, said he intends to buy himself more room to roam and repay the kindness other townspeople have shown his family. Wisconsin lottery winner will support family with winnings
A Marshfield, Wisconsin, man is a million dollars richer, at least before taxes, after winning the Powerball lottery. Rafael Ruiz Jr., 28, is also Wisconsin's first Power Play winner. They called me at work. I couldn't believe it. I didn't wanna leave right away cuz I thought she was playing a joke on me, Ruiz said. He matched all five Powerball numbers, which typically means winning $200,000. But since he chose the Power Play option, his winnings multiplied by five. Coming to Baltu ...

Georgia man wins $1 million in lottery
A Gainesville man's life may have been opened to new possibilities after winning a $1 million Georgia Lottery prize. Donald Grant, 58, won the lottery after purchasing a World Class Millions ticket, a Georgia Lottery instant game, with his morning cappuccino. This is a lucky day, Grant said of winning his prize. Ohio Mega Millions lottery winner claims prize anonymously
The owner of a winning Mega Millions ticket claimed their prize Friday. But the identity of the winner won't be made public after two attorneys claimed the prize on behalf of a blind trust which Ohio law allows. Chillicothe attorney Deborah Barrington and Columbus attorney Ronald Rowland, cotrustees of The Ross County Beneficiary Trust, claimed the $75.6 million prize for the winner at the Ohio Lottery's offices in Cleveland.
